Output 73d50a19a914da631182c675b595bfdda0b7338e157cc04bd443075afd464900:10

value
154936
script pubkey
OP_HASH160 OP_PUSHBYTES_20 172994e8ecc1478cee56bbaa191323596389d99f OP_EQUAL
address
33oVH6qwNiGYLgP95v6QeG7Q6qVkExDzud
transaction
73d50a19a914da631182c675b595bfdda0b7338e157cc04bd443075afd464900
spent
true